Dr. Stanley Wallach, 1928-2011

 

 Stanley Wallach, M.D., MACN, CNS

 The American College of Nutrition announces the death of Dr. Stanley Wallach (82).

He served as Chief Executive of the American College of Nutrition from October 1993 to October 2003.  He also served as President of the American College of Nutrition from 1987-1989 and received its Mastership Award in 1999.

 

Dr. Wallach was also a founder of The Paget Foundation, the first Chairman of the Foundation’s Advisory Medical Panel from 1977-1984, a member of the Foundation Board of Directors from 1990 to his death including serving as Board President for many years.

 

Dr. Wallach was Chief, Medical Service, Veterans Administration Medical Center, Albany NY from 1973-1983 and Chief, Medical Service, Veterans Administration, Bay Pines FL, from 1983- 1990. He was Professor of Internal Medicine, University of South Florida, from 1988-1992.

 

His military service included active duty in the U.S. Naval Reserve, Medical Corps from 1958-1960 and Captain in the U.S. Naval Reserve for thirty one years.

 

Dr. Wallach served as Director, Endocrinology and Metabolic Bone Disease Center, Hospital for Joint Diseases, New York, NY from 1993-2001.

 

Dr. Wallach is survived by Pearl his beloved wife of thirty eight years and his loving family.
